From: Chris Dailey Date: Tue, 24 Nov 2020 20:17:16 +0000 (-0500) Subject: Add rewrite_filename for sim -vcd argument. X-Git-Tag: working-ls180~191^2 X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=cdc802e4b77e6fecd250850c99469b81c2c7f104;p=yosys.git Add rewrite_filename for sim -vcd argument. --- diff --git a/passes/sat/sim.cc b/passes/sat/sim.cc index 75f922dba..3ba66bd33 100644 --- a/passes/sat/sim.cc +++ b/passes/sat/sim.cc @@ -810,7 +810,9 @@ struct SimPass : public Pass { size_t argidx; for (argidx = 1; argidx < args.size(); argidx++) { if (args[argidx] == "-vcd" && argidx+1 < args.size()) { - worker.vcdfile.open(args[++argidx].c_str()); + std::string vcd_filename = args[++argidx]; + rewrite_filename(vcd_filename); + worker.vcdfile.open(vcd_filename.c_str()); continue; } if (args[argidx] == "-n" && argidx+1 < args.size()) {